Technical Director

Location: Haydock Area
Contract Type: Permanent
Salary: £70000+

Our client, a market-leading UK manufacturer of Building Products, is seeking a Technical Director to drive their technical development and support their strategic growth in the industrial, commercial, and residential construction sectors.

Position Overview

As the Technical Director, you will play a pivotal role in leading and directing a team of technical designers, CAD/Revit operators, and estimators. You will be responsible for ensuring the seamless integration of technical solutions into the company's product portfolio, contributing to the development of high-quality solutions.

Responsibilities
  • Lead and manage a team of technical designers, CAD/Revit operators, and estimators

  • Drive technical development assignments to integrate solutions into the product portfolio

  • Identify and select strategic design and technical assignments to develop high-quality solutions

  • Support work winning activities through the delivery of feasibility designs

  • Build and maintain an external network of client, supplier stakeholders, and trade associations

  • Ensure the implementation of technical solutions meets quality standards and client expectations

  • Co-own ISO accreditation and audit processes

  • Explore new technologies to enhance current solutions

  • Establish and embed an estimating function for commercial viability

  • Collaborate with commercial functions to support strategic growth

Requirements
  • Bachelor's degree or equivalent in Engineering, Construction, Architecture, or similar

  • Proven experience in Quality Assurance & BoM Control/Estimation

  • Knowledge of MEP systems

  • Demonstrated technical project management and leadership experience with multi-disciplinary teams

  • Understanding of internal stakeholder engagement and work winning activity

  • Track record in implementing improvement measures in a technical department

  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ills

  • Strong interpersonal and relationship management abilities

  • Capability to translate technical concepts into practical commercial solutions

  • Experience in implementing and managing ISO and associated certification standards
